Fixing notification issues on LeEco devices

Fixing notification issues on LeEco devices


Overview

Like many Chinese phone manufacturers, LeEco tailor their devices to be very aggressive in closing down applications and services in the background which can lead to missed notifications.

In this post I will outline the modifications required to minimise this issue, along with a few other tips on setting up a LeEco device.

Auto Launch

Settings / Permissions / You have allowed n apps to auto launch

Select all the applications that are allowed to start up when the phone boots. This should include all apps for which you require notifications - e.g. email clients, messenger applications, social network apps etc.

Power Saving Management

Settings / Battery / Power saving management

Ultra-long standby during sleep - turn off
Lock-screen cleanup - turn off
App protection - select all apps from which you require notifications
Battery assistant - turn off

While in the Battery section, I like to enable Status bar - battery percentage

Background Resource Control

Dial *#*#46360000#*#*

Enable background resource control - turn off

Notification management

Settings / Notification management

This allows us to define notification type on a per-app basis. The defaults for this are usually acceptable, but it is worth taking a look at the options available here.

Settings / Display / LED notification light


Enable Others if you wish to have a visual notification from third party applications.

Mobile data restriction

Downloads app / Settings

In order to download apps and files over the mobile / cell network we need to lift the restriction.

Data connection download notice - No limit.

Extracting system features on Android devices

Extracting system features on Android devices



I am trying to build a lightweight host based intrusion detection system for Android devices. The project is based on the previously developed Andromaly framework for detecting malware on Android mobile devices. Unfortunately, the Andromaly project has been shut down for some time because of uncertain reasons.

The main goal of the project is to create an application that will determine whether some other application is normal or malicious. In order to do so, my application will collect certain system features from the device and apply machine learning algorithms to create a model that will be able to properly classify new applications as normal or malicious. The features will be collected when both normal and malicious applications are running on the device.

The authors of Andromaly framework noted that these six features differ the most from normal and malicious applications: Anonymous_Pages, Total_Entities, Battery_Temperature, Running_Processes, Mapped_Pages, Garbage_Collection. So, the first step in the project was to extract these features from an Android device.

The amount of memory used for anonymous pages can be easily obtained from the file /proc/meminfo which can be accessed on any Android device. Inside the file there is an entry named AnonPages, which contains the amount of memory used for anonymous pages expressed in kilobytes. In the same way one can get the amount of memory used for mapped pages which is stored in the Mapped entry.

The number of total entities on the system can be obtained from the file /proc/loadavg. In that file the first three numbers show the number of running tasks on the system averaged over the last 1, 5 and 15 minutes. The fourth entry shows the current number of runable task and the total number of entities(tasks) in the system.

The current battery temperature can be accessed via the Android API. In order to get the battery temperature we need to listen to an intent(ACTION_BATTERY_CHANGED) and register a receiver when that intent is fired. In the receiver we can then get the current battery temperature. This can be seen in the code below.

Code 1. Getting battery temperature from a device

The number of running application processes on a device can also be accessed with the Android API. Firstly it is necessary to retrieve an ActivityManager instance which holds the global system state. Once the ActivityManager is obtained it can be used to return a list of all application processes currently on the system. The code can be seen below.


Code 2. Retrieving the number of running processes

The last feature, Garbage_Collection, is a bit tricky, since I am not sure what the authors of Andromaly framework meant by it. One idea is that this feature was meant to show how often the Android garbage collector is called, but I was not able to get that information at this moment. How to Flash MIUI 8 China Alpha ROM 6.5.31 on any Mi & Redmi smartphone

1. Users of Mi5 / Mi Max / Mi Note smartphones need to unlock the bootloader first. Check here for guide on how to unlock bootloader on MIUI devices.

2. Download the latest Mi Flash tool and install on your computer.

3. Turn off the device and boot into Fastboot mode (press the Volume key and Power button at the same time).

4. Now you need to connect your device to PC.

5. Then download the MIUI 8 China Alpha ROM from the below link and extract the same. Open the file folder and copy its path.

6. Paste the ROM folder path in the Flash tool address bar and tap on �Refresh�. Now the tool automatically recognize the device.

7. Just tap �Flash� button located beside the Refresh button to start the flashing process.

8. Be patience and wait till the progress bar completely turns green which indicates that the rom has been successfully installed.

How to install iOS 11 themes on Xiaomi MIUI phones

Step 1: Once you�ve downloaded the MIUI theme in .mtz extension on your computer, copy the same into your device storage or SD card using a standard USB cable.

Step 2: Go to app drawer on your device and launch the Themes app.

Step 3: Under Theme tab, you need to select Offline.




Step 4: Here you�ll see the list of all offline themes that comes pre-installed within your smartphone.


Step 5: Scroll down and tap on Import.


Step 7: Now, access to the appropriate folder, and tap the .mtz theme file which you have saved to device storage.

Step 8: The theme will install and it will be shown along with other offline themes.

Step 9: Select the theme and tap on �Apply�.

That�s it! The new theme will be automatically applied on your device.

Note: The above guide is compatible only with Xiaomi Mi & Redmi phones running on MIUI 8. If you�re have a Xiaomi phone with other version, then there is chances that the steps and screenshots will be different.

Tool Studio eMMC Download Tool Flash and Unbrick All Qualcomm Android Devices

Tool Studio eMMC Download Tool Flash and Unbrick All Qualcomm Android Devices


Tool Studio eMMC Download Tool is a sophisticated and advanced download tool for servicing Qualcomm Android devices. Using ToolStudio eMMC Download Tool, you can flash stock ROM on Qualcomm android devices, backup, restore, repartition and even refurbish your Qualcomm android devices. Lest I forget, one important purpose of Tool Studio eMMC Download Tool is that; it easily debrick Qualcomm android devices than most other Qualcomm Download Tools.
Here, I discuss how to flash Qualcomm android devices using Tool Studio eMMC download tool.

Flash, Unbrick Qualcomm Android Device with Tool Studio

Flashing Qualcomm Android Devices Using Tool Studio eMMC Download Tool

1. Download ToolStudio eMMC Download Tool from your ABC Package folder here. Once downloaded, decompress the ZIP File on a folder on your PC and then, launch the setup contained in that folder as Admin.

2. Open the text file contained in the same folder as the setup file. It contains the password for Tool Studio eMMC Download Tool. Copy the password and paste it where Tool Studio eMMC download tool asks/prompts for password and click OK.

3. Download and install your Qualcomm android devices drivers on your PC. If your device has been bricked, you must download and install Qualcomm QDLoader HS USB Bulk drivers too. Download Qualcomm QDLoader HS USB Bulk Drivers from here.

4. Download the Stock Firmware for your Qualcomm android device. NOTE: Tool Studio can flash .mbn and .bin files with .xml file map only.
For LG Android Device Users, see: How to Convert .KDZ Files to .MBN and .BIN Files.

5. If the firmware you downloaded is compressed in a .zip or .rar file, decompress/unzip the firmware you downloaded in a folder on your PC.

6. Now, on Tool Studio, click browse and navigate to the folder where you unzipped the firmware and select it.

7. To view the phones partitions contained in that firmware and select which ones are to be flashed, click Advance. And the next Window will display all the partitions.
Mark the ones you wish to flash or Select All.
Qualcomm Device firmware partitions -tool studio

8. Now, connect the phone to the PC. Make sure you remove the battery from the phone and insert it again. If the phone has a sealed battery, simply put off the phone.

9. Wait few seconds, then click Refresh. Tool Studio should display the connected device and its COM Port.
Qualcomm Device COM Port -Tool Studio Refresh

10. Now, click Start All or Start to begin the flashing operation. The flashing operation should not take more than 5 minutes. When the flashing operation is complete, Tool Studio will fill the progress bar with GREEN ink and you may then disconnect the device from the PC.
Start -Tool Studio Flash Qualcomm Device

Flash Complete -Tool Studio eMMC Download Tool

Possible Issues with Tool Studio eMMC Download Tool

As common with every other flash tools, there are certain errors and issues which are common with Tool Studio eMMC Download Tool. Below here, I discuss three (3) of the commonest issues you might encounter while using Tool Studio to flash or debrick any Qualcomm android device and how to resolve each of the issues.

1. Tool Studio eMMC Error: cant find ram
Tool Studio Error Cant Find RAM
SOLUTION:
    i. When Tool Studio displays the error "cant find ram", click Advance to display the list of the partitions contained in the firmware. If the RAM section is fade, check to make sure that RAM is present in that firmware folder.
    ii. It is also possible that the RAM file is present but it is not named in the format Tool Studio recorgnises. The RAM should be named as: MPRG8936mbn or something similar. If you have the RAM file in that firmware folder, simply rename it accordingly.
2. Tool Studio eMMC Error: wait for ram mode failed
Tool Studio Error Wait for RAM Mode Failed
SOLUTION:
    i. Tool Studio eMMC Download Tool displays "wait for ram mode failed" if; 1. The RAM file in that firmware is not for that phone. 2. The phones eMMC partition is corrupt/damaged. Try another firmware/ram or consider replacing your eMMC.
3. Tool Studio eMMC Download Tool could not identify your boot image or boot image not found.
SOLUTION:
    i. Ensure that boot image file is present in that firmware.
    ii. Ensure that the boot image file is named in a format Tool Studio recorgnises e.g 8936_msimage.mbn. If boot image is present in the firmware but not named rightly, simply rename it.
Those are three common errors you may encounter while using Tool Studio eMMC download tool. If you have other questions, please, add your comment in the box below.
